On Saturday evening, Baylor picked up some more steam in the 2021 class by landing Dallas (TX) Jesuit High School offensive lineman Ryan Lengyel‍ and in the process earning a head to head win over Texas on the recruiting trail.

The 6’5, 275-pound offensive tackle prospect becomes commit No. 19 in the 2021 class and the third offensive line prospect.

The Baylor staff was able to hold off a late push by the Texas Longhorns who offered just a week ago but ultimately the relationship Lengyel had with the Baylor staff won out.

The three-star prospect chose Baylor over offers from Texas, Florida International, Liberty, Wyoming, and UL-Monroe among others.
